Job summary
The GP practice receptionist is
responsible for undertaking a wide range of reception duties and providing
support to the multidisciplinary team. Duties may include, but are not limited
to, greeting and directing patients, effective use of the appointment system,
booking appointments, processing of personal information and assisting patients
as required.
Main duties of the job
To act as a central
point of contact for patients, the distribution of information, messages and
enquiries for the clinical team, liaising with the multidisciplinary team
member and external agencies such as secondary care and community service
providers.

Job description
Job responsibilities
The core
responsibilities of the receptionist are as follows. On occasion, there may be
a requirement to carry out tasks not listed below, that are within the
reasonable scope of the role.
-
Maintain
and monitor practice appointment system
-
Process
personal, telephone and e-requests for appointments
-
Answer
incoming phone calls, dealing with the callers request appropriately
-
Signpost
patients to the correct service
-
Initiating
contact with and responding to, requests from patients, team members and
external agencies
-
Data entry
of new and temporary registrations and relevant patient information as
requested
-
Input data
as necessary onto patients healthcare records
-
Direct
requests for information to relevant team members i.e., SAR, DVLA forms, insurance/solicitors
letters
-
Manage all
queries as necessary in an efficient manner
-
Carry out
system searches as requested
-
Support
all clinical staff with general tasks as required
-
Photocopy
documentation as required
-
Maintain a
clean, tidy and effective working area
-
Monitor
and maintain the reception area and notice boards
In addition to the
core responsibilities, the Receptionist may be requested to;
1.
Action
incoming emails and correspondence as necessary
2.
Complete
opening and closing procedures in accordance with the rota
3.
Partake in
audit as directed by the audit lead
4.
Support
admin team, providing cover during absences
5.
Scan
patient related documents and attach scanned documents to patients healthcare
record

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
